Types of Windows
Before diving into the installation process, it is crucial to comprehend the kinds of windows readily available and their specific benefits. Below is a summary of common window types:
Window TypeDescriptionBenefitsDouble Glazing Warranty-HungTwo movable sashes that move vertically.Exceptional ventilation and easy to clean.Casement WindowsHinged at the side and opens external.Enables maximum air flow and energy efficiency.SlidingOpens horizontally by Sliding Windows to the side.Easy to operate and needs less space.BayComposed of three windows extending from a wall.Develops extra interior space and boosts views.PictureRepaired, non-operable window designed for views.Provides optimum light and unblocked views.AwningHinged at the leading and opens outside from the bottom.Suitable for rainy areas, as it allows ventilation without letting water in.Force-OperatedOpens via a mechanism like a motor.Suitable for hard-to-reach areas and boosts availability.
Understanding these choices assists house owners choose windows that align with their preferences and needs.
Benefits of Professional Window Installation
While some house owners may think about a DIY approach to window installation, working with experts provides several benefits:

Picking suitable windows based on style, product, and energy efficiency rankings is a crucial very first action. Think about factors such as your local climate and building regulations.
Action 2: Prepare Your Home
This includes clearing the area around the windows, removing window treatments, and protecting the flooring and furniture from particles.
Step 3: Assess Existing Windows
Check the current windows to determine how they are installed and which parts require elimination.
Step 4: Remove Old Windows
Utilizing a pry bar, carefully separate the existing window frames while decreasing damage to the surrounding structure.
Step 5: Prepare the Opening
Guarantee the window opening is clean, level, and prepared for the new windows. This may consist of fixing any damaged wood.
Action 6: Install New WindowsDry Fit: Place the window in the opening to ensure it fits effectively.Secure the Window: Fasten the window in location, ensuring it is level and plumb.Seal the Edges: Use caulk or weatherstripping to seal spaces.Insulate: Foam insulation can boost energy performance.Action 7: Finishing Touches
Set up any interior and outside trims, examining that whatever is sealed and protected.
Step 8: Cleanup
Dispose of old windows and any debris properly. Clean the installation location.
Common FAQs About Window Installation1. For how long does window installation take?
The time required for window installation differs depending on the number of windows being set up, the complexity of the task, and the climate condition. Usually, a professional team can finish the installation of a complete home within one to three days.
2. Is window replacement an excellent financial investment?
Yes, replacing windows can increase a home's value and improve energy effectiveness, frequently leading to lower energy costs. Homeowners recover about 70% to 80% of the Window Contractor replacement expenses during resale.
3. Can I set up windows myself?
While experienced DIYers may attempt to install windows on their own, professional installation is typically recommended due to the complexity and precision included in guaranteeing correct sealing and fit.

Are energy-efficient windows worth the cost?
Purchasing energy-efficient windows can lead to significant cost savings on heating & cooling costs, improved comfort levels in your home, and tax credits in some areas. They also add to minimizing ecological effect.
